Bucks County Opens Cooling Centers to Help Seniors, Homelessness Deal with Extreme Heat

These centers will allow those in need to cool down during the heat wave.

With an Excessive Heat Warning in effect in Bucks County since Thursday, the county has opened cooling centers to help seniors and people experiencing homelessness deal with the extreme weather, according to a staff report from WFMZ 69 News.

The cooling locations are available in Upper and Lower Bucks, in Riegelsville, Morrisville, Warminster, Fairless Hills, Bristol, and Bensalem. These will run from 10 AM – 6 PM for the duration of the weather warning.
